Sourcing guidance for Auto Contactor
What are the key technical specifications to consider when selecting an auto contactor for industrial or automotive applications?
When sourcing auto contactors, you must prioritize Rated Operational Voltage (Ue) and Rated Operational Current (Ie) to ensure they match your system's power requirements. For automotive applications, specifically EVs, look for High-Voltage DC Contactors capable of handling 400V to 800V DC. Additionally, verify the Utilization Category (e.g., AC-3 for squirrel-cage motors or DC-1 for non-inductive loads) and ensure the Coil Voltage (e.g., 12V, 24V, or 220V) is compatible with your control circuit. Contact material (such as silver alloy) is critical for minimizing electrical wear and extending the mechanical life cycle (typically >1 million operations).
Which international compliance standards are mandatory for auto contactors in global trade?
To ensure market entry and safety, contactors must adhere to IEC 60947-4-1, which is the primary international standard for low-voltage switchgear and controlgear. For the North American market, UL 508 or UL 60947-4-1 certification is essential. If you are exporting to Europe, the CE Mark and RoHS compliance (Restriction of Hazardous Substances) are mandatory. For automotive-specific contactors, check for IATF 16949 quality management system certification at the manufacturer level to ensure automotive-grade reliability.
How can I evaluate the thermal performance and durability of a contactor before bulk purchasing?
Request the Temperature Rise Test Report to ensure the device operates within safe limits under full load. High-quality contactors should feature flame-retardant housing (UL94-V0 rated). For harsh environments, verify the IP Rating (e.g., IP20 for standard panels or IP67 for sealed automotive units). You should also inquire about the Arc Extinguishing Technology, such as magnetic blowouts or vacuum sealing, which are vital for preventing contact welding and ensuring long-term operational safety.
Cross-Border Procurement Risks and Strategies for Auto Contactors
What are the primary risks when sourcing electrical components like contactors internationally?
The biggest risks include counterfeit components and substandard raw materials (e.g., using copper-clad aluminum instead of pure copper for terminals). Another risk is incompatibility with local grids; always double-check the rated frequency (50Hz vs 60Hz) before finalizing the order.

What logistics and shipping precautions should be taken for sensitive electrical goods?
Contactors contain delicate internal springs and magnets. Ensure the supplier uses anti-static packaging and shock-absorbent padding. For sea freight, specify moisture-proof vacuum packaging to prevent oxidation of the silver contacts. When shipping to countries with strict customs, ensure the HS Code (typically 853641 or 853649) is correctly declared to avoid delays and ensure the correct Import Duty is applied.
